Description
Aimed at professionals studying C, programmers, and programming students learning C, this book focuses on what a programmer needs to know in order to get a program running in C. It emphasizes how each new programming feature in C relates to the use of pointers to provide a thorough understanding of the numerous applications throughout C. The book presents a procedural style in its approach to the functions in C, emphasizes the C file functions and explains the logical implementation of files - text, formatted, and record, and uses many short, clear, and simple programs to highlight each new feature of C. It includes a chapter on C++ with practical examples emphasizing data protection and file management.
